Application in Process for PR
Hi,
I have applied for PR from within Canada. However when I go to check the status here: Check your application status I cannot find the option to check for PR from within Canada under the CEC class.
Any help would be greatly appreciated. I have tried using both the UCI and Application numbers from my AOR, which I received back in June. I know the status would not of changed but it would give me great comfort that I am able to check.

Re: Application in Process for PR
Which visa office did you apply under? It would usually come under an out of Canada application, rather than in Canada, so that may be why you can't find it.
And were you born in the UK? If so, make sure you use that country on the drop down menu i.e. England/Scotland etc, rather than 'UK & Colonies'.

Re: Application in Process for PR
Hi
1. CEC is an out of Canada application, they are processed CPC-Ottawa (which is classified as a visa office outside Canada)
2. You were born in a country in the UK, Wales, NI, Scotland, England, pick one and don't use UK for place of birth.
